Job Description

STV is seeking a professional Water/Wastewater Engineering Specialist to join our Water/Wastewater division in Longview, TX. STV specializes in the planning, organization, and development of engineering activities for the construction and maintenance of water and wastewater facilities.

If you are innovative, enjoy problem solving and technical challenges, like collaborating to find the best solution, and want to be in an environment where you are valued as you learn and grow, we would like to talk with you.

Responsibilities include:

  • Production of contract documents including plans and specifications

  • Perform pipeline hydraulic flow and pressure calculations.

  • Perform pump calculations and develop system curves for sizing pumps.

  • Water and Wastewater treatment process engineering and design support.

  • Prepares construction and design cost estimates.

  • Develops project specific specifications.

  • Perform engineering duties in planning and designing water and wastewater pipelines, pumping, storage, and treatment systems.

  • Responsible for or willingness to learn project management, client interface and business development of future projects.

  • Makes site visits during design and construction to inspect facilities.

  • Review construction shop drawings and submittals for compliance with project design documents.

Skills and Experience:

  • Bachelor's or Masters degree in Civil Engineering from an ABET accredited University or NCEES equivalent.

  • Experience or specific course work in water and wastewater systems is a plus.

  • Successful completion of the FE exam (EIT) or the ability to complete in the first 6 months.

  • Ability to work and communicate well will other design disciplines.

  • Possesses strong organizational and time management skills.

  • Ability to work independently.

  • Strong oral and written communication skills.

  • Experience withAutoCAD, ArcGIS is a plus.

  • Participation in AWWA, WEF, ASCE and other professional organizations as well as joining a committee would be a plus.
